Method for determining limits of a determination of an offset at least in a range of a voltage-lambda characteristic of a first lambda probe arranged in an exhaust passage of an internal combustion engine with respect to a reference voltage-lambda characteristic
Method for determining limits of a determination of an offset at least in a range of a voltage-lambda characteristic of a first lambda probe arranged in an exhaust passage of an internal combustion engine with respect to a reference voltage-lambda characteristic
A method is proposed for determining limits of a determination of an offset, at least in a region of a voltage-lambda characteristic curve of a first lambda probe (14) arranged in an exhaust duct (14) of an internal combustion engine (10) with respect to a reference voltage-lambda characteristic curve in which a first measurement signal of the first lambda probe (14), a second measurement signal of a second lambda probe (18) and an oxygen balance of a catalytic converter (16) between the first lambda probe (14) and the second lambda probe (18) are used for the determination, wherein the oxygen balance comprises an oxygen input into the catalyst (16), an oxygen discharge from the catalyst (16), and an oxygen storage level difference of the catalyst (16), an upper limit based on a first assumption, from which a first value for a sum of oxygen output and Oxygen storage level difference results, and a lower limit based on a second assumption, from which a second value for a sum of oxygen discharge and oxygen storage level difference results, is determined, wherein the first value is greater than the second value.
